    <description>The definitional reach of assets includes urban land, making it taxable, while the statutory exclusion for agricultural land removes qualifying agricultural land from wealth tax. A statutory modification substitutes an item expressly mentioning agricultural land and growing crops, grass or standing trees, thereby affecting the operation of the exclusion for later assessment years.</description>
